Output 29045099abc8345ff9b74a89d0633cf37331c40c25c822b09ea7c6753707bcb9:11

value
38586280
script pubkey
OP_0 OP_PUSHBYTES_20 20f8b4b39e440b87aaf8150ba1bc457c71438ec0
address
ltc1qyrutfvu7gs9c02hcz596r0z903c58rkqs5v4da
transaction
29045099abc8345ff9b74a89d0633cf37331c40c25c822b09ea7c6753707bcb9
spent
true